police
Examples This example shows how to configure a policer that drops packets if traffic exceeds 1 Mb/s average rate
with a burst size of 20 KB. The DSCPs of incoming packets are trusted, and there is no packet
modification.
Switch(config)# policy-map policy1
Switch(config-pmap)# class class1
Switch(config-pmap-c)# trust dscp
Switch(config-pmap-c)# police 1000000 20000 exceed-action drop
Switch(config-pmap-c)# exit
This example shows how to configure a policer, which marks down the DSCP values with the values
defined in policed-DSCP map and sends the packet:
Switch(config)# policy-map policy2
Switch(config-pmap)# class class2
Switch(config-pmap-c)# police 1000000 20000 exceed-action policed-dscp-transmit
Switch(config-pmap-c)# exit
You can verify your settings by entering the show policy-map privileged EXEC command.
Related Commands Command Description
class Defines a traffic classification match criteria (through the police, set,
and trust policy-map class configuration commands) for the
specified class-map name.
mls qos map policed-dscp Applies a policed-DSCP map to a DSCP-trusted port.
policy-map Creates or modifies a policy map that can be attached to multiple
ports to specify a service policy.
set Classifies IP traffic by setting a DSCP or IP-precedence value in the
packet.
show policy-map Displays quality of service (QoS) policy maps.
trust Defines a trust state for traffic classified through the class
policy-map configuration or the class-map global configuration
command.
